The illustrious Castle Pines Golf Club, renowned for its challenging course and stunning scenery, will host the 2024 BMW Championship. This marks a historic return as the PGA Tour hasn’t graced this venue since the memorable 2006 International. For this pivotal event, the course is set to stretch over an impressive 8,130 yards, providing a rigorous test for the participating golfers and an exciting spectacle for fans.
Event Format and Rules
Contrast to its last PGA Tour event which utilized the Modified Stableford system, the 2024 BMW Championship will follow a traditional 72-hole, stroke-play contest format. This structure emphasizes consistency and skill across four rounds, ensuring that only the most proficient golfers rise to the top of the leaderboard.
Stakes and Competition
The BMW Championship stands out as the crucial second leg of the 2024 FedEx Cup Playoffs, a pinnacle series that defines careers and seasons. The event will feature the top 50 players, each battling not only for the championship title but also for their share of the substantial $20 million purse. The grand winner of the tournament will walk away with a handsome $3.6 million, underscoring the high stakes and intense competition this championship spurs among top-tier golfers.
